PENTAX 17 wins Camera GP 2025 Editors Choice R&D Award
TOKYO, May 16, 2025 -RICOH IMAGING COMPANY, LTD. is pleased to announce that the PENTAX 17 has won the prestigious Camera GP 2025 Editors Choice R&D Award of the Camera Grand Prix 2025 in Japan.
The Camera Grand Prix is held every year by the Camera Journal Press Club (CJPC), it celebrated its 40th anniversary last year. The Camera Grand Prix2025 awards were selected from products released in the Japanese market between April 1,2024 and March 31,2025.
The Camera Grand Prix is decided by a vote by the Camera Grand Prix Executive Committee, which is elected every year. The Camera Grand Prix is selected by members of the Camera Journal Press Club, media managers affiliated with the Camera Grand Prix, external selection committee members commissioned by each media, and a special selection committee of scholars, camera mechanic writers, photographers, etc. commissioned by the Camera Grand Prix Executive Committee of that year. The Camera Grand Prix 2025 "Camera of the Year" and "Lens of the Year" were selected by a selection committee consisting of 57 people (including organizations).
In addition, awards are given in five categories: the "Readers Award-Camera" and the "Readers Award-Lens", which are decided by general user votes, the "Editors Choice R&D Award", "Editors Choice Technology Award" and "Editors Choice Lifetime Achievement Award", which is selected by Camera Journal Club(CJPC) members from all photography-related products.


Criteria for the selection of the PENTAX 17 as Camera GP2025 Editors Choice R&D Award winner
The PENTAX 17 is a camera that has been released as a product that reevaluates the appeal and shooting experience of film photography in the age of digital cameras. The camera uses a half-size format that uses 35mm film, allowing us to take twice as many pictures as usual with one roll of film. In addition, photographers can enjoy shooting in a vertical format. The camera is designed to allow photographers to enjoy operating it, with features such as a manual winding lever and zone focusing system, and by avoiding full automation, it aims to bring out the individuality and creativity of the photographer. We have selected it as the Camera Grand Prix 2025 Editors Choice R&D Award in recognition of its symbolic role in conveying the joy of analog photography to the modern age.
